“Candles for sale!” A young woman’s voice caught Devan’s attention, candles were good gifts for a fiancee. He walked over to the tables, sniffing several before he found one he thought she would like, sweet berries rising up to caress his nose.

“How much for this one? I like the sweet smell of it.”

The lady smiled, “Juniper is a sweet scent indeed. Four luks, please.” The Lord pulled up five and exchanged them for the candle.

She wrapped it up with a red bow perfectly balanced. He thought it would be a nice wedding gift for her, a new light for their new life together. He wasn’t ready to cut off his hair, but it was tradition and his mother was always a stickler for traditions. His father had done it when he married Rose and now it would be his turn. They would not be attending however, duties were too busy in Dejan for the Jarl to leave, almost ever. The city was a wreck, with low lives and thieves running around.

And then there was the Crows Crown. Led by a ruthless leader, some of the worst people served him. Devan had problems with one of them specifically. A ruthless assassin by the name of Nicholas Wolf.

No one had seen his face, no more than his verdant eyes shone through his black mask that covered everything up to his nose. Even his hair was black and with the rain - it was always slicked back. Devan knew that this was the wolf that the woman was speaking of, he almost had the chance to kill him earlier.

Wolf had taken the one thing in the world that mattered to Devan.

His brother.

Devan’s older brother was being primed to take over, the man being six years older than him. Daeric was sixteen at the time and would have taken over in less than two years. He had done some questionable things, yes, but he was a good leader and he would have made an amazing Jarl or even King. Daeric would be the one here looking for a bride, not Devan.

Devan was twelve when he saw the shadowy figure slip through his bedroom window, assuming that the young Prince was asleep and into his brother’s room. His brother was found with his throat slit only moments later. He only saw the eyes of the murderer, a boy no older than fourteen, but they haunted him for the rest of his life. Devan would never forget those glowing orbs of pure green, nor could he. Some nights when he thrashed and shook with night terrors - it was those eyes that haunted him.

As he grew older, he vowed to take down the Crows Crown and kill all the members in a public execution so that Dejan would never have to worry about assassins like these again. It didn’t matter if people employed them, they would be just as guilty if caught.
